Chicken Souvlaki Recipe


Submitted by alleycat_lady

Makes 4 servings


a greek dish

Ingredients
1 lb chicken breasts, cut into strips
1 tbsp oregano
1 tbsp pepper
1 tbsp dill
1 1/2 tbsp olive oil
1 1/2 tbsp lemon juice
Directions
  1. Place chicken into a ziplock bag with oregano, dill and pepper. Shake to make sure all pieces are coated. Refrigerate and let marinade for at least 30 minutes.

  2. Mix olive oil and melon juice and set aside.

  3. Cook chicken on a non-stick skillet. After cooked immediately dizzle with lemon and olive oil mixture.

  4. Serve with Tzatziki, Feta Cheese and Pita Bread.
